Saturn V rockets powered each of the 13 Apollo missions launched between 1967 and 1973, including the first Moon landing on July 20, 1969.
Web19 jul. 2024 · Of the 21 lunar landings, 19—all of the U.S. and Russian landings—occurred between 1966 and 1976.
